.container[data-v-56deffdc]{flex-direction:column;left:0;position:absolute;top:0}.container[data-v-56deffdc],.smart-waterfall[data-v-56deffdc]{display:flex;height:auto;width:100%}.smart-waterfall[data-v-56deffdc]{gap:16px;padding:10px}.waterfall-column[data-v-56deffdc]{display:flex;flex:1;flex-direction:column;gap:16px}.waterfall-item[data-v-56deffdc]{-moz-column-break-inside:avoid;border-radius:8px;box-shadow:0 2px 8px #0000001a;break-inside:avoid;cursor:pointer;opacity:1;transition:transform .3s ease,box-shadow .3s ease}.image-wrapper[data-v-56deffdc],.waterfall-item[data-v-56deffdc]{overflow:hidden;position:relative}.image-wrapper[data-v-56deffdc]{width:227px}.image-wrapper img[data-v-56deffdc]{display:block;min-height:100px;-o-object-fit:cover;object-fit:cover;transition:transform .3s ease;width:100%}.selection-overlay[data-v-56deffdc]{z-index:3}.gray-overlay[data-v-56deffdc],.selection-overlay[data-v-56deffdc]{inset:0;position:absolute}.gray-overlay[data-v-56deffdc]{background-color:#00000080}.close-icon[data-v-56deffdc]{border-radius:50%;height:auto;position:absolute;right:10px;top:-20px;width:35px;z-index:4}.close-icon img[data-v-56deffdc]{height:100%;-o-object-fit:contain;object-fit:contain;width:100%}.delete-overlay[data-v-56deffdc]{align-items:center;cursor:pointer;display:flex;height:24px;justify-content:center;opacity:0;position:absolute;right:10px;top:10px;transition:opacity .3s ease;width:24px;z-index:5}.waterfall-item:hover .delete-overlay[data-v-56deffdc]{opacity:1}.delete-overlay img[data-v-56deffdc]{height:100%;-o-object-fit:contain;object-fit:contain;width:100%}.image-error[data-v-56deffdc]{background:#00000080;border-radius:4px;color:#999;font-size:14px;left:50%;padding:10px;position:absolute;top:50%;transform:translate(-50%,-50%);z-index:1}.loading-more[data-v-56deffdc]{align-items:center;color:#666;display:flex;gap:10px;justify-content:center;padding:20px}.loading-spinner[data-v-56deffdc]{animation:spin-56deffdc 1s linear infinite;border:2px solid #f3f3f3;border-radius:50%;border-top-color:#111;height:20px;width:20px}@keyframes spin-56deffdc{0%{transform:rotate(0)}to{transform:rotate(1turn)}}.no-more-data[data-v-56deffdc]{color:#999;font-size:14px;padding:50px;text-align:center}
